For over 20 years, Softdocs has proudly served the education space by designing, developing and delivering the Enterprise Content Management (ECM) solutions needed to digitize business processes and streamline the experience provided to students and staff. Recognizing the new challenges facing the K-12 market and continuing the theme of transformation that has found its way into every organization over the past 18 months, particularly within the Education space, Softdocs has announced a ramping up of efforts to enhance its SaaS-based offering and expand its market reach. The latest move? Three new hires for the Softdocs K-12 Account Executive team—Chloe Cowart, Nate Palermo and Corey Pitz.

Cowart comes to Softdocs from PowerSchool, seeking to lead K-12 districts and schools in their efforts to reimagine everyday operations thorough electronic forms, workflow automation and content management. Palermo, also formerly of PowerSchool, is leveraging his extensive familiarity with K-12 and education technology to help interested districts remove paper and the need for manual processes, significantly improving the student, staff and teacher experience. With a shared passion for the K-12 space, Pitz understands the needs of today’s districts and schools, as well as the role the cloud plays in that pursuit—having previously served as an Account Executive for LINQ before arriving at Softdocs.

This expansion of the Softdocs K-12 Account Executive team, as well as Development and Professional Services teams, comes after Softdocs added 74 new educational institutions to its cloud environment in 2020, including 38 migrations from legacy ECM systems. With disruption ongoing, many districts and schools are conducting a thorough review of key processes and systems—in many cases choosing to shift from on-premises to the cloud for added security and accessibility benefits. By building out its strategic K-12 teams, Softdocs is confident in the continued success of the districts, schools and other educational institutions choosing to leverage Softdocs solutions.
